A report of four unrecorded species of opisthobranch molluscs from Korea

  • Four species of opisthobranch molluscs collected from Jeju Island were identified as Pleurobranchus peronii Cuvier, 1804, Pleurobranchus weberi (Bergh, 1905), Aplysiopsis nigra (Baba, 1949) and Stiliger aureomarginatus Jensen, 1993. All of the species and genera examined here are new to Korea. Pleurobranchus peronii and P. weberi were easily distinguished to each species by dorsal tubercles and markings. In this report, we provided descriptions and photographs of these species for identification.

A report of 23 unrecorded bacterial species belonging to the class Alphaproteobacteria

  • To study the biodiversity of bacterial species, here we report indigenous prokaryotic species of Korea. A total of 23 bacterial strains affiliated to the class Alphaproteobacteria were isolated from various environmental sources including seaweeds, seawater, fresh water, wetland/marsh, tidal sediment, plant roots, sewage and soil. Considering higher than 98.8% 16S rRNA gene sequence similarities and formation of a well-defined phylogenetic clade with named species, it was confirmed that each strain belonged to the predefined bacterial species of the class Alphaproteobacteria. There is no official report of these 23 species in Korea; 20 species of 16 genera (Mameliella, Yangia, Paracoccus, Ruegeria, Loktanella, Phaeobacter, Dinoroseobacter, Tropicimonas, Lutimaribacter, Litoreibacter, Sulfitobacter, Roseivivax, Labrenzia, Hyphomonas, Maricaulis, Thalassospira) in the order Rhodobacterales and 3 species of a single genus (Brevundimonas) in the order Caulobacterales. Gram-staining, cell morphology, basic biochemical characteristics, isolation sources, optimum temperature, growth media, and strain IDs are detailed in the species description as well as Table 1.

New Report on Two Species of Hippolytid Shrimps (Crustacea: Decapoda: Caridea) Collected at Sea Cucumber Farm, East Sea, Korea

  • Two species of hippolytid shrimps, Eualus kuratai Miyake and Hayashi, 1967 and Heptacarpus igarashii Hayashi and Chiba, 1989, were collected at a sea cucumber farm from the East Sea. These species are described and illustrated for the first time in Korea. Eualus kuratai is closely related to E. middendorffi; however, it lacks a dorsomedian spine on the fourth and fifth abdominal somites. Heptacarpus igarashii can be easily distinguished from other Korean Heptacarpus species due to its short rostrum that lacks ventral teeth on margin. This report extends the previously known ranges from Japan and Korea. In Korea, both genera, Eualus and Heptacarpus, have seven species according to the present report, respectively; moreover, hippolytid shrimps now consist of 31 species of nine genera.

A report of three newly recorded benthic foraminiferal species from Korea

  • Foraminifera are unicellular eukaryotes widely distributed in marine and transitional marine environments. They play important roles in marine food webs and geochemical cycles and have physiological properties like the formation of calcareous tests and nitrogen respiration. Research on species diversity, distribution and endemism are essential in biogeography and biodiversity conservation. Here, we report three unrecorded species of foraminifera (Hemirotalia foraminulosa, Planispirillina denticulogranulata and Oolina brevisolenia) collected from Jeju Island and the South Sea (Korea). Planispirillina denticulogranulata is the second Planispirillina species recorded in Korea, which can be distinguished from congeners by its tubercles on the ventral side and grooves on the spiral suture. Hemirotalia foraminulosa is differentiated from the only congener H. calvifacta by multiple-scattered pits on the umbilicus, and it is the first report of Hemirotalia from Korean water. Oolina brevisolenia has specific bifurcating costae that characterize it from other congeners. This study contributes to documentation of the foraminiferal biodiversity in Korea, moreover, provides an essential basis for the expanded studies on modern foraminifera.

Eight New and Four Newly Recorded Species of Chironomidae (Insecta: Diptera) from Korea

  • Adult chironomids were collected by various methods, such as light traps, sweeping on grasses, aspiration of light-attracted adults, and sweeping of swarming males with insect nets at various localities. All collected specimens were slide-mounted and identified. I report eight species new to science: Chironomus jangchungensis n. sp., Demicryptochironomus paracamptolabis n. sp., Demicryptochironomus wontongensis n. sp., Microtendipes paratamagouti n. sp., Polypedilum macrohemisphere n. sp., Eukiefferiella busanensis n. sp., Psectrocladius paratogaminimus n. sp., and Pseudosmittia seosania n. sp. I also report four species for the first time in Korea: Chironomus fujiprimus Sasa, Pentapedilum convexum Johannsen, Tanytarsus smolandicus Brundin, and Tanytarsus oyamai Sasa. All species are fully described with illustrations. This is the first report of the genera Eukiefferiella and Pseudosmittia in Korea.

Report on the chromosome numbers of four Carex taxa in Korea (Cyperaceae)

  • We report the meiotic chromosome numbers of four Carex taxa from Korean populations. Three are the first reports made on taxa from Korean populations: Carex appendiculata (Trautv. & C. A. Mey.) $K{\ddot{u}}k$. ($n=27_{II}$), C. fernaldiana H. $L{\acute{e}}v$. & Vaniot ($n=33_{II}$), and C. metallica H.$L{\acute{e}}v$. ($n=15_{II}$). Reports on the other species expand the range of variation in the chromosome number within a taxon, C. miyabei Franch. (n = $43_{II}$, $44_{II}$, $45_{II}$). Carex L. (Cyperaceae) consists of more than 2,000 species worldwide and is the most species-rich genus in Korea. The species diversity in the genus has been hypothesized to be associated with the chromosome variation, but chromosome information pertaining to Korean Carex taxa is not well known. This report updates the chromosome number inventory on Korean Carex to 24 out of 180 taxa.

A report of 27 unrecorded bacterial species within the class Alphaproteobacteria isolated from various sources of Korea in 2021

  • In 2021, a total of 27 bacterial strains were isolated from soil, tree bark, moss, wetland, sea sediment, tidal flat, seawater and seaweed within Republic of Korea. Based on the analysis of 16S rRNA gene sequence (>98.7% sequence similarity), these isolates were assigned to the class Alphaproteobacteria as unrecorded species in Korea. The 27 strains were classified into the 10 families: Maricaulaceae of the order Caulobacterales; Brucellaceae, Methylobacteriaceae, Nitrobacteraceae and Rhizobiaceae of the order Hyphomicrobiales; Micropepsaceae of the order Micropepsales; Rhodobacteraceae of the order Rhodobacterales; Azospirillaceae of the order Rhodospirillales; and Erythrobacteraceae and Sphingomonadales of the order Sphingomonadaceae. There is no official report of these 27 species in Korea. Therefore, we report 27 isolates as unrecorded species, and described isolation sources, Gram-stain reactions, physiological and biochemical properties and morphologies of these strains.

A report of 21 unrecorded bacterial species of Korea belonging to the phylum Bacteroidota isolated in 2021

  • During screening for indigenous prokaryotic species in Republic of Korea in 2021, a total of 21 bacterial strains assigned to the phylum Bacteroidota were isolated from a variety of environmental habitats including pine cone, seaweed, soil, sea sediment, brackish water and moss. Based on the 16S rRNA gene sequence similarity value of more than 98.7% and formation of a robust phylogenetic clade with the type strain of the closest bacterial species, it was found that the 21 strains belong to independent and recognized bacterial species. There has been no official report that the identified 21 species have been isolated in Republic of Korea up to date. Therefore, 16 species in six genera of two families in the order Flavobacteriales, two species in two genera of two families in the order Cytophagales, one species in one genus of one family in the order Chitinophagales and two species in one genus of one family in the order Sphingobacteriales are proposed as unrecorded species of the phylum Bacteroidota isolated in Republic of Korea. Their Gram reaction, colony and cell morphology, basic phenotypic characteristics, isolation source, taxonomic status, strain ID and other information are described in the species descriptions.

A report of 35 unreported bacterial species in Korea, belonging to the phylum Firmicutes

  • In an investigation of indigenous prokaryotic species in Korea, a total of 35 bacterial strains assigned to the phylum Firmicutes were isolated from diverse habitats including natural and artificial environments. Based on their high 16S rRNA gene sequence similarity (>98.7%) and formation of robust phylogenetic clades with species of validly published names, the isolates were identified as 35 species belonging to the orders Bacillales (the family Bacillaceae, Paenibacillaceae, Planococcaceae, and Staphylococcaceae) and Lactobacillales (Aerococcaceae, Enterococcaceae, Lactobacillaceae, Leuconostocaceae, and Streptococcaceae). Since these 35 species in Korean environments has not been reported in any official report, we identified them as unrecorded bacterial species and investigated them taxonomically. The newly found unrecorded species belong to 20 species in the order Bacillales and 15 species in the order Lactobacillales. The morphological, cultural, physiological, and biochemical properties of the isolates were examined and the descriptive information of the 35 previously unrecorded species is provided here.

First Report of Ceriporiopsis resinascens (Phanerochaetaceae, Basidiomycota) in Korea

  • An unrecorded Ceriporiopsis species was collected at Mt. Gariwang, Gangwon Province, in 2008. Based on morphological characteristics, such as a fully resupinate basidiocarp, a reddish white to pinkish poroid hymenophore and a monomitic hyphal system with clamp connections, the species was identified as Ceriporiopsis resinascens. This is the first report of Ceriporiopsis resinascens in Korea. We confirmed the identity of the species as Ceriporiopsis resinascens based on ITS sequence analysis.
